Ticket #— Floor 9 Opening Prep, Brindlemoor House

Hi facilities folks, Floor 9 opens to staff next Monday and we need a few things squared away before then. Lift access is live, but the two side doors by the kitchenette are still on the old lock config — please reprogram them before Friday. Also, signage for the quiet rooms hasn't arrived, so pop up the temporary printed ones for now. Until the badge readers sync, the interim door code for Floor 9 is below.

door code, bajop-bajog: bdg-DSWAC-43621

Action item 7 (owner: platform team): The Burrowcast notifier emits roughly 40k log lines per minute during fanout, which drowned out the actual error signal in this incident. We will enable adaptive sampling at 1:50 for INFO-level entries while keeping WARN and above unsampled. Support should know that per-request trace IDs remain fully searchable. The sampling rules and override steps are documented here.

runbook for badug-kadup: https://confluence.zemvarlabs.internal/projects/browse/display/projects/bd1b

14:22 — Confirmed the Verdantly admin dashboard regression was introduced by the dark-mode theming pass. The token overrides shipped without fallback values, so the audit panel rendered white-on-white for operators on the legacy skin. Mira disabled the theme flag via config push at 14:25, restoring contrast. Root fix is to gate new tokens behind the skin version check. The build carrying the hotfix is identified by the token below.

trace token, fajep-yagep: htk31_9f84d966d50d2e729c799259be7496d

Ticket #— Missed pick-up: off-site backup tapes

Summary: The scheduled Tuesday collection of the weekly backup tapes from the Ashgrove Annex did not occur. The sealed tape case (eight LTO cartridges, tamper band intact) remained at the secure cabinet overnight, which breaches our retention procedure. Please arrange a priority re-run with Carrowell Couriers for tomorrow before 10:00 and confirm the driver's name against the authorised list beforehand. At the hand-over itself, the coordinator must relay this single instruction to the driver:

handover note for kagep-kagup: the holok holdor courier leaves the rusix sorox fenwyn ledger at gate 3590 under passcode 092644